RAND(3) 						     Library Functions Manual							   RAND(3)

NAME
rand, srand - random number generator
SYNOPSIS
#include <stdlib.h> void srand(unsigned seed) unsigned rand(void)
DESCRIPTION
Rand uses a multiplicative congruential random number generator with period 2**32 to return successive pseudo-random numbers in the range from 0 to RAND_MAX. The generator is reinitialized by calling srand with 1 as argument. It can be set to a random starting point by calling srand with what- ever you like as argument.
